Choosing the Right Rice

When it comes to weight loss, the type of rice you choose can make a significant difference. While white rice is the most commonly consumed variety, it undergoes processing that removes the bran and germ, stripping away most of the fiber and nutrients. Brown rice, on the other hand, retains the outer layers and is much higher in fiber, vitamins, and minerals. By opting for brown rice, you can increase your fiber intake, promoting better digestion and aiding in weight loss.

Cooking Methods

Stovetop Method

The stovetop method is the most common way of cooking rice. To cook rice for weight loss, use a ratio of 1:2, meaning one cup of rice to two cups of water. Bring the water to a boil in a pot and add the rice. Reduce the he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for about 40-45 minutes. Allow the rice to rest for a few minutes before fluffing it up with a fork. The longer cooking time of brown rice compared to white rice is due to its higher fiber content.

Rice Cooker Method

Using a rice cooker is another convenient way to cook rice, especially if you want to save time. Simply measure the desired amount of rice and rinse it thoroughly. Add the rinsed rice to the rice cooker along with the appropriate amount of water. Most rice cookers have a water-to-rice ratio chart for different types of rice. Once the rice cooker finishes cooking, allow the rice to sit for a few minutes before serving.

Portion Control

While rice is a healthy option for weight loss, it is essential to practice portion control. Consuming excessive amounts of rice can hinder your weight loss goals. A well-balanced diet should consist of appropriate portions of rice, protein, vegetables, and healthy fats. One serving of cooked rice is generally considered to be around half a cup or about the size of a tennis ball. It is crucial to listen to your body’s hunger and fullness cues and adjust your portion sizes accordingly.
